The 'type of progress envisaged above is the outstanding char
acteristic of the year 1955 in the field of industrial health. It
has not come about within this on year, nor is it, in any sense,
complete. Certain activities of recent years have taken definite
form within the year, however, providing conventional landmarks
which may not bo disregarded or taken lightly. Of those the most
symbolic is the affiliation of Occupational Hedicin with Aviation
Medicine and Public Health within the American Board of Preventive
Medicine, which was approved at the last meeting of the American
Medical Association in.Atlantic City in Juno. The significance of
this affiliation lies not so ranch in the immediate event as in the
manner of its accomplishment, the validity of the claim made by
industrial physicians that occupational medicine is a specialised
field of medical knowledge and practice, and the promise "which the
accomplished fact holds for the future of the specialty.
Behind the recognition of t h e .specialty by the Council on
Modical Education and Hospitals of the American Medical Association,
and by the Advisory Board for the Medical Specialties, lies the
development of a sound core of professional training in a number
of schools In this country and abroad, by means of which, more than
by any other criteria, the nature and scope of occupational med
icine ( c o m o n l y spoken of as industrial medicine in its limited
application to industry, as differentiated from its general concern

with, the impact of loan's occupation upon his health) came to be . defined* Back of this training# too, lay the still crowing aware ness of industrial physicians and medical educators that the hygienic needs of our Indus urial society demand, for their satis faction, the application of a now brand of preventive medicine; that, without abandoning the disciplines and techniques of preven tive medicine which have served the community well in the era characterized largely by microbio tic threats to human health, there is urgent need to cultivate the new methods of a preventive medicine that will bring under control the hazards to health created by m a n 's applications of the physical sciences to his dally life, The palliative character of industrial medicine, in its earlier preoccupation with the treatment of the end results of human exposure to dangerous environmental conditions, and with its emphasis on disability and workmen's compensation, is giving way rapidly to the viewpoints and techniques of industrial hygiene, environmental appraisal and control, and rehabilitation. The . ultimate social and-economic consequences of this change in view^ ' point and strategy can only be imagined, but they begin to be appo rent
The effects of the new orientation of industrial medicine, now potentiated by formal professional sanction, m a y be expected to find their way into general medical practice, by virtue of the growing demands made upon physicians generally to spend some part of their time in industrial practice, especially in small Indus tries. Approximately half of the American work force is employed
h
in such industries, and the almost uttor lack of preventive medicine within these thousands of establishments is on out standing problem of industrial and community health, American medicine has shown groat capacity for responding to clear calls to duty, and it is to be expected that the new knowledge of preventive medicine in industry will find expression and appli cation through appropriate empia sis on this aspect of the train ing and praetico of physicians, A hopeful sign of progress in this direction has been manifest in the consideration given to this subject in recent months in conferences of practicing phy sicians and medical educators.
The recognition and the definition of occupational medicine as a specialised field of medical research, training and practice has even wider potential consequences, howover, than those sug- ' gosted above* It has been apparent, recently, that m o d e m Indus trial production and distribution have altered not only the envlronment in which the work of the world is done but also the physical basis of modern life, The hazards of Industry show them selves on streets and highways, and find their way into man*s ' food and water supplies and into the air he breathes, in the form of chemical contaminants! they invade the household as the machinery of comfort and convenience, and as chemicals that find a wide range of usage, The evidence for the reality of these hazards is eoen in the h igh incidence of fatal and disabling accidents, especially on the highways and in the home. In the latter connection, a now mechanism for the distribution of per tinent Information in emergency has come into existence, as a
5
sign of the times and also as a significant note of progress, in that "poison centers" have boon and ore being set up in a number of cities. Those are in readiness to convey to physicians the available information for the prompt handling of cases of acciden tal poisoning nox* so common, especially among small children.
